Instruction

Prepare the ingredients: Rinse the chicken thighs and pat dry with a kitchen towel. Drying the remaining water will ensure that the spices stick to the Chicken. Lay the chicken thighs in the baking tray with the skin facing upward. 

Add the cooking oil: Drizzle the cooking oil on the Chicken. Coat both sides of the Chicken with the oil so the bottom does not stick to the baking tray. This step also prevents the Chicken from burning. Generously sprinkle the Cajun spice on the chicken thighs. Salt is not needed, as the Cajun spice already contains salt.

Bake the Cajun chicken thighs: Preheat the oven to 200ºC or 400ºF. Place the casserole in the oven and bake the Chicken for fifty minutes. After baking for forty minutes, check if the chicken thighs are undercooked and adjust the temperature accordingly. If the Chicken cooks faster than expected, you can always reduce the temperature.

Serve immediately: Serve the baked Cajun chicken thighs with your favorite side dishes.

Should you cover the Baked Chicken thighs with a Foil?

No, to ensure that the skin has a perfect crisp, it is unnecessary to do so.

What if the Baked Chicken thighs are still pink after baking?

Under-baked Chicken is possible, depending on the size of the chicken thighs and the heat distribution in the oven. If this occurs, add the chicken thighs to a pan with olive oil and heat the pink parts until fully cooked.

How long does it take to defrost Chicken?

If you place a tray of frozen Chicken in the fridge, it will take eight to twelve hours to thaw thoroughly. However, if you put frozen Chicken in cold water, it should thaw in one to two hours.

Please resist the urge to thaw Chicken in warm water, as this could encourage the growth of bacteria.

How do you store and reheat baked Cajun chicken?

Let the baked chicken thigh cool to room temperature before storing it in the fridge. Keep the Chicken in an airtight container, which will last up to four days in the refrigerator and up to two months frozen in the freezer. 

To reheat the baked Chicken, use a stovetop, which is simpler than the oven and achieves a crispy texture. Preheat the skillet on medium-low heat. Add one tablespoon of cooking oil, and then add the chicken thighs.

Reheat for about 5 minutes on each side or 8 minutes on each side of the frozen Chicken. The easiest way to reheat the baked chicken thighs is to put them in the microwave and heat them for 2 minutes on the highest setting or thaw the frozen Chicken before reheating it. However, the Chicken will not be crispy like the other reheating methods.

Ingredients

  • 900 g Chicken thighs with skin and bones
  • 3 Tbsp Cajun spice
  • 3 Tbsp Cooking oil

Instructions

  • Prepare the ingredients: Rinse the chicken thighs, and dab them dry with a kitchen towel, and place them in a single layer on a baking tray.
  • Add oil and Cajun spice: Pour the cooking oil on top of the chicken, as well as under the chicken. Generously and evenly sprinkle the Cajun spice on the chicken thighs. Add salt after tasting the baked chicken, as the Cajun spice already contains salt.
  • Bake the Cajun chicken thighs: Preheat the oven to 200ºC or 400ºF. Place the baking tray in the oven and bake the chicken for fifty to fifty five minutes. After baking for forty minutes, check if the chicken is getting burnt or undercooked, and then adjust the temperature accordingly. Make sure to keep the oven fan off and have the chicken uncovered.
  • Serve immediately: Serve the baked Cajun chicken immediately with side dishes.
